Types of Documents and Extraction Challenges

Different document types present unique challenges for information extraction:

Structured Documents

  • Forms

  • Invoices

  • Tables

  • Standardized reports

Structured documents organize information in predictable formats, making extraction relatively straightforward with the right tools.

Semi-structured Documents

  • Emails

  • Web pages

  • Technical manuals

  • Financial statements

These documents follow some organizational patterns but may contain variations that complicate automated extraction.

Unstructured Documents

  • Letters

  • Articles

  • Books

  • Social media posts

Unstructured documents present the greatest challenge for information extraction, requiring more sophisticated approaches.

Automated Extraction Technologies

Technology has revolutionized document information extraction:

Optical Character Recognition (OCR)

OCR technology converts printed or handwritten text into machine-readable text, serving as the foundation for digital extraction from physical documents. Modern OCR systems achieve accuracy rates exceeding 99% under optimal conditions.

Natural Language Processing (NLP)

NLP enables computers to understand human language, facilitating extraction of meaningful information from text. Advanced NLP systems can identify entities, relationships, sentiment, and intent within documents.

Regular Expressions

For structured data with consistent patterns, regular expressions provide a powerful tool for extraction. Learning basic regex syntax can dramatically improve your extraction capabilities for formatted information like dates, phone numbers, and codes.

What is the difference between data mining and document information extraction?

Data mining typically involves analyzing large datasets to discover patterns, while document information extraction focuses specifically on identifying and extracting predefined information types from document sources.

Can information extraction tools handle handwritten documents?

Modern OCR systems can process handwritten text with increasing accuracy, though results vary based on handwriting legibility and consistency. Specialized handwriting recognition systems achieve the best results.

What programming skills are needed for creating custom extraction tools?

Basic knowledge of regular expressions and a programming language like Python provides a strong foundation. Libraries like NLTK, spaCy, and TensorFlow offer powerful extraction capabilities with moderate learning curves.
